A wide class of single-variable holomorphic representation spaces are constructed that are associated with very general sets of coherent states defined without the use of transitively acting groups. These representations and states are used to define coherent-state path integrals involving phase-space manifolds having one Killing vector but a quite general curvature otherwise.
